This audio offers a gentle return to some of the most impactful insights from the Never Mind Your Mind course. Together, we explore how to unhook from unhelpful thinking patterns, relate to the mind with greater understanding, and cultivate a more compassionate, spacious inner world. It’s a moment to pause, reflect, and remember: your mind is not your enemy — it’s just trying to help in the only way it knows how. This session is rooted in Contextual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T), an evolution of traditional CBT that incorporates mindfulness and psychological flexibility. A key approach within this framework is Acceptance and Commitment Therapy (ACT), which helps us relate to our thoughts in a more open and adaptive way.
